Company description
Rixos Premium Qetaifan Island North comprises a 345-key hotel, along with a souq encompassing 11,000sqm of leasing space, a beach club, a theme park, and a waterpark. The resort boasts panoramic views of the Arabian Gulf. Rixos plans to provide a platform for showcasing Qatar as a tourism destination. One of the country's biggest draws will be Qetaifan Island North's Meryal Waterpark attraction. The Rig 1938 is the world's highest tower of its kind, reaching 82 metres.
Job description
This position will be responsible for managing the engineering team, setting technical direction, and ensuring that all projects are executed efficiently, safely, and in alignment with company goals. This role combines strategic leadership with hands-on technical expertise.
Responsibilities:
- Lead and manage the engineering and maintenance team to ensure the smooth operation of all systems, facilities, and technical equipment.
- Oversee preventive and corrective maintenance programs for HVAC, electrical, plumbing, mechanical, and life safety systems.
- Ensure full compliance with health, safety, and environmental regulations, as well as brand and local standards.
- Support in developing and managing departmental budgets, cost control measures, and energy efficiency initiatives.
- Collaborate with senior management and other departments to support smooth hotel operations.
- Plan and execute capital improvement and renovation projects.
- Ensure timely completion of maintenance requests and guest service calls.
- Conduct regular inspections of the property to identify areas for improvement and ensure consistent maintenance of facilities.
- Lead, motivate, and train team members to deliver exceptional service and technical performance.
